Important Considerations Before Buying an Inflatable Hot Tub

Inflatable hot tubs have become increasingly popular, offering a convenient and affordable alternative to their permanent counterparts. They’re perfect for those seeking relaxation and hydrotherapy without the commitment and expense of a traditional hot tub. However, they’re not for everyone.

Who should consider an inflatable hot tub?

* Renters or those with limited space.
* Individuals or small families looking for occasional relaxation.
* Budget-conscious buyers seeking a cost-effective hot tub experience.

Who should probably skip it?

* Large families or frequent entertainers.
* Those seeking a permanent backyard fixture.
* Buyers wanting advanced features like waterfalls or multiple jets.

Before purchasing, consider:

* Space: Ensure you have adequate space for the inflated tub and pump.
* Power supply: You’ll need a dedicated outdoor outlet.
* Maintenance: Factor in the cost of chemicals and filter replacements.

Durable and Long-Lasting Construction

Crafted from puncture-resistant, three-ply laminated material, the Intex Simple Spa is built to withstand regular use and the elements. This durable construction provides peace of mind, knowing your investment is protected.

Energy-Efficient Heating System

The Intex Simple Spa incorporates an energy-efficient heating system that gradually warms the water to your desired temperature. While it may take some time to reach the maximum 104 degrees Fahrenheit, the gradual heating process helps conserve energy and maintain a comfortable water temperature.

What Are People Saying?

Before taking the plunge, I always like to see what other users have to say. Across the internet, reviews for the Intex Simple Spa are overwhelmingly positive. One happy customer raved about how easy it was to set up and how effectively it soothed their tired muscles. Another reviewer mentioned it was a fantastic alternative to expensive, permanent hot tubs, highlighting its affordability and convenience.

However, some users did mention a few drawbacks. One common observation was that it does take time for the water to reach the maximum temperature. Others pointed out that while the bubble jets are relaxing, they don’t offer the intensity of a traditional jacuzzi.
